1. Detailed Georgia Surrogacy Costs in 2026

The total cost of surrogacy in Georgia typically includes medical fees, surrogate compensation, legal and agency service fees. Below is the general reference range for 2026 (in USD):

  • Basic Surrogacy Package: Approximately $45,000 – $65,000 (includes egg donation + surrogacy + medical services)
  • Self-Egg Surrogacy: Approximately $35,000 – $55,000 (client provides eggs and embryos)
  • Third-Party Assistance Programs (e.g., egg donation, sperm donation): Additional $8,000 – $15,000
  • Legal and Translation Fees: $3,000 – $6,000
  • Travel, Accommodation, and Living Support: $5,000 – $12,000 (depending on length of stay)

2. Georgia Surrogacy Process (2026 Latest Version)

  1. Initial Consultation and Evaluation: Submit medical reports of both parties; remote consultation with Georgian doctors.
  2. Signing Contracts and Legal Documents: Georgian law guarantees parental rights for the intended parents; contracts must be notarized and court-certified.
  3. Embryo Culture and Screening: In vitro fertilization, blastocyst culture, and PGT genetic screening at a reputable fertility center.
  4. Surrogate Matching: Select a surrogate mother meeting health standards, usually completed within 2-4 weeks.
  5. Embryo Transfer and Pregnancy Confirmation: Blood test for pregnancy 12 days after transfer; success rate approximately 60%-70% (based on high-quality embryos).
  6. Pregnancy Management: The surrogate attends regular prenatal check-ups; intended parents can monitor the baby's condition in real time.
  7. Birth Certificate Processing: After birth, obtain a Georgian birth certificate and apply for a Chinese travel document or passport to return home.
